在uni-app中封装数据请求是一个常见的需求,这可以提高代码的可维护性和复用性。以下是基于你的提示,对uni-app数据请求封装的详细解答: 一、确定uniapp数据请求的基本流程 在uni-app中,数据请求的基本流程包括以下几个步骤: 引入uni.request方法:这是uni-app提供的网络请求接口。 设置请求参数:包括请求的URL、方法...
3、Uni-App 引用npm第三方库 4、Uni-App + Vuex 数据持久化 下面我们来具体看看 Uni-App API调用(网络请求、获取位置等) 一、uni.request封装成Promise uni.request(OBJECT) OBJECT对象描述: 1、根目录下新建 commons/http.js 文件 2、封装uni.request() 有人肯定会问,人家uni.request()已经挺好的了,为什么...
新建文件夹util 文件api.js const BASE_URL="https://www.19870125.xyz";//域名抽取const HEADER={ 'content-type': 'application/x-www-form-urlencoded' };//头部export const myRequest=(options)=>{returnnewPromise((resolve,reject)=>{ uni.request({ url:BASE_URL+options.url, method:options.meth...
页面vue文件中请求方法uni.request({//获取信息url: getApp().globalData.https + '/api.php/Index/index', data: {}, method:'POST', header: getApp().globalData.header, dataType:'json', success:function(res) { console.log(res); } }) APP.vue 文件中设置全局变量exportdefault{ globalData: {...
使用flyio封装请求 1、npm init -y 在项目根目录初始化package.json文件 2、npm install flyio --save 下载安装flyio包...
Axios封装请求后端接口 安装axios npm install axios 1. 在main.js中添加 import Axios from 'axios' Vue.prototype.$axios = Axios; new Vue({ el: '#app', Axios, components: { App }, template: '<App/>' }) 1. 2. 3. 4. 5.
锋选菁英App(uniapp),使用ColorUI-UniApp 进行布局, 图鸟UI组件库,使用luch-request库发请求 - 封装luch-request 发请求,home 页面获取动态分类数据 · RanGuMo/QingFeng_uniapp@64b5b16
1.开发环境 uni-app 2.电脑系统 windows10专业为版 3.在使用uni-app开发的过程中,我们需要数据请求,但是使用uni-app 框架自带的请求方式我们需要写很多重复的代码,我进行了封装,希望对你有所帮助,为什么要封装h5端数据请求还要封装微信端的数据请求,下面会有所解释!
uni-app如何封装请求接口数据并挂载到全局 在做项目的时候,小项目可以不考虑封装,项目大的话就得考虑请求接口封装了,我们在改动的时候也方便,而且节省了很多代码。以下是一个简单的封装例子,供大家参考和使用 1、 首先在更目录下新建util文件夹,在里面新建个api.js...
4、Uni-App + Vuex 数据持久化 下面我们来具体看看 Uni-App API调用(网络请求、获取位置等) 一、uni.request封装成Promise uni.request(OBJECT) OBJECT对象描述: 1、根目录下新建 commons/http.js 文件 2、封装uni.request() 有人肯定会问,人家uni.request()已经挺好的了,为什么非的在封装一次了?